Peninsula Clean Energy Authority issues this Request for Proposals (RFP) to seek offers from qualified providers for technical support on CPUC request for energy efficiency funding through the application proceeding process and ongoing reporting and compliance assistance for existing CPUC funded program.
Proposals must be received on or before April 18, 2025 by 5:00 PM and submittal must be by email to programsolicitations@peninsulacleanenergy.com with the subject “Proposal - <Vendor Name> - ATA Technical Support”.

Peninsula Clean Energy (PCE) is issuing this RFP to solicit proposals for two distinct scopes of work related to its CPUC-funded energy efficiency programs:
Proposers may choose to respond to one or both scopes of work, and proposals will be evaluated accordingly.
This RFP supports PCE’s broader objective of enhancing its capacity as an energy efficiency program administrator under the CPUC framework, leveraging the statutory right of CCAs to administer such programs under Public Utilities Code 381.1. The selected consultant(s) will play a critical role in ensuring compliance for existing programs and preparing PCE for future program administration aligned with CPUC requirements and PCE’s strategic goals
